How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Burlingame?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Burlingame Studio Apartments | $2,323 | $900 | $8,678 |
| Burlingame 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,073 | $1,577 | $10,000+ |
| Burlingame 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,250 | $1,705 | $10,000+ |
| Burlingame 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,616 | $2,649 | $10,000+ |
| Burlingame 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,200 | $3,200 | $3,200 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Burlingame
How much are Studio apartments in Burlingame?
There are currently 2,063 Studio Apartments in Burlingame with rent ranges from $900 to $8,678 with an average price of $2,323.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Burlingame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Burlingame ranges from $1,577 to $17,738 with an average monthly rent of $3,073.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Burlingame c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Burlingame range from $1,705 to $22,457.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,250.
How expensive are Burlingame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 471 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Burlingame on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,649 to $16,987 - averaging $5,616 for the location.
